No Cause of Death Yet for California Mom Who Died Day After Miami Cosmetic Procedure

CG Cosmetic Surgery said it is its "preliminary understanding" that the woman's death is unrelated to its services

What to Know

  • Delma Pineda died at the age of 44 on March 6.
  • She will be buried in California on Friday.
  • The circumstances of her death are not yet clear.

An official cause has not yet been released in the death of a mother of two from California who died one day after undergoing a cosmetic procedure in Miami, according to her ex-husband, who chooses to remain anonymous.

Delma Pineda, died at the age of 44 on March 6 following a procedure at CG Cosmetic Surgery, located at 2601 SW 37th Ave. in Miami.

Pineda's ex-husband said a medical examiner told the family that she had swelling in her brain, sustained a stroke, which then caused a heart attack. NBC 6 has not yet been able to independently confirm the circumstances of Pineda's death.

Pineda's family has acquired a lawyer. The ex-husband said she will be buried in California on Friday.

CG Cosmetic Surgery said it is its "preliminary understanding" that Pineda's death was unrelated to its services.

"Our prayers go out to the family of the deceased," CG Cosmetic's attorney said in a statement. "CG Cosmetic has been in touch with the family throughout this entire process. It is our preliminary understanding that the events giving rise to this incident are unrelated to CG Cosmetic's services."

A GoFundMe page said that Pineda's "family is devastated."

"She was a single mother who worked as a medical assistant. She spent her life taking care of others and now we want to take care of her and her family," the GoFundMe page reads. "Unfortunately, she and her 4-year-old son were in Miami away from all of her family and friends when she passed away."
